Yes, many moving companies provide boxes and packing supplies to their customers. If companies offer full-service packing, then they will not only provide the materials, but also pack the items/belongings for the customers. This way, the entire process of packing and moving the items is in the company’s hands, and the customer can just…relax.

When hiring any moving company, it is important to carefully check and understand the quote that you’re furnished with. In many cases, the quote only contains the cost of the moving job, and every tiny additional service that you may need comes with an extra charge. While there is no problem in charging extra for said services, it has to be made clear and transparent beforehand so that the customer knows just how much they’ll have to spend.
Keeping that in mind, you have to be careful about checking the cost of the provided boxes. Make sure to ask if the boxes are included in the full service or excluded. In the latter case, you will have to pay extra on top of the initially quoted amount.
Many companies don’t provide moving boxes, but they do offer moving supplies that you can borrow and use for the duration of your move. For example, many moving companies offer plastic shipping containers/crates that you can use to load up your belongings and move them easily. Once you’re done, you can hand the containers back to the company.
If you’re hiring the movers for packing + moving, then they will take care of the former by themselves using the “rented” containers. They will simply charge you for the use of the containers and then take them back once they are done.
This option can actually be quite handy, as it saves you the cost of buying boxes outright, and it also saves you the hassle of worrying about what to do with them once you’re done shifting your items.

If your moving company is offering boxes on a separate charge, then it is usually cheaper to get boxes on your own instead of coughing up the additional money.
Why?
Because in many cases, you can get the boxes for free instead of having to pay for them. And even when you do pay for them (such as when buying from Target or Amazon), they usually come really cheap.
On the other hand, if your moving company is offering the boxes as a part of its full-fledged service, then the question of acquiring them on your own doesn’t arise. The boxes become quite affordable when acquired as a part of a larger service.
